On Christmas Eve, I want to offer this reminder:
Children don’t remember the logistics. They remember the feelings.
They remember the warmth of being held during the excitement…
The humor when something didn’t go as planned…
The moment when you took a breath and chose connection over correction.
Holiday pressure can pull us into striving for “perfect.”
But the brain science is clear: kids thrive on presence, attunement, and being with us in the moment.
